Go to file
Konstantina Galouni 1500084e78 [Aggregator & Library | new-theme]: [Bug fix] Set properly "dashboard" and "adminToolsPortalType" properties and show "Check compatible EOSC services" button in eosc portal too.
1. env-properties.ts:
   a. In Dashboard type added "aggregator".
   b. In PortalType added "funder", "ri", "project", "organization", "aggregator", "eosc".
2. environments/: Set "dashboard" property to "aggregator" and only for eosc set "adminToolsPortalType" property to "eosc".
3. entitiesSelection.component.ts: Added check if adminToolsPortalType is "eosc".
4. resultLanding.component.ts: In method "hasRightSidebarInfo()" check if adminToolsPortalType is "eosc" to show "Check compatible EOSC services" button.
5. resultLanding.component.html: Show "Check compatible EOSC services" for adminToolsPortalType "explore" or "eosc".
2022-05-16 17:14:50 +03:00
e2e [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00
src [Aggregator & Library | new-theme]: [Bug fix] Set properly "dashboard" and "adminToolsPortalType" properties and show "Check compatible EOSC services" button in eosc portal too. 2022-05-16 17:14:50 +03:00
.browserslistrc [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00
.gitignore [Aggreagator]: Remove clean-library. Add gitignore. Add gitmodule 2021-07-19 17:32:59 +03:00
.gitmodules initial commit for new-theme branch 2022-04-26 17:19:38 +03:00
README.md [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00
angular.json [Aggregator | new-theme]: angular.json: Update UIKIT scripts (get them from the "openaire-theme" folder instead of the "common-assets"). 2022-05-16 16:42:03 +03:00
package.json Apply initial changes for eosc explore 2022-02-18 16:58:47 +02:00
prometheus.ts [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00
server.ts [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00
tsconfig.json [Aggregator | Trunk]: Upgrade to angular 11 2021-07-14 11:47:56 +00:00

README.md

Aggregator

This project was generated with Angular CLI version 7.3.10 and has been updated to 11.2.14.

Install packages

Run npm install (maybe needs sudo), a script that will delete unused files from library will be run.

Development server

Run npm start for a dev server. Navigate to http://localhost:4400/. The app will automatically reload if you change any of the source files.

Build - CSR

Use the npm run build-dev for a development build.
Use the npm run build-beta for a beta build.
Use the npm run build-prod for a production build.

Build - SSR

Use the npm run build:ssr-dev for a development build.
Use the npm run build:ssr-beta for a beta build.
Use the npm run build:ssr-prod for a production build.

Run SSR

npm run serve:ssr will run the last server build.

Webpack Analyzer

In order to analyze bundle size you can run npm run webpack-bundle-analyzer

Running unit tests

Run ng test to execute the unit tests via Karma.

Running end-to-end tests

Run ng e2e to execute the end-to-end tests via Protractor.